Tony Khan isn’t losing sleep over WWE trying to compete with AEW—and he’s not afraid to mock anyone who thinks they’ll succeed.

After this week’s episode of AEW Collision, the AEW President took a moment to thank fans for tuning in. But that positivity was met with negativity when a fan jumped into his replies with a bold prediction: “Wwe is gonna bring you down and close shop can’t wait.”

Tony Khan didn’t let it slide. Instead of firing off a rant, he kept it short and sarcastic—dropping a GIF of Star Trek’s Captain Jean-Luc Picard saying: “That will be the day.”

Clearly unfazed, Khan gave a sassy shrug at the notion AEW is anywhere near shutting its doors. The timing of the exchange is notable, as WWE continues booking major Premium Live Events directly against AEW programming. Most recently, WWE scheduled another big show to go head-to-head with AEW All Out—a move many see as intentional.

But if Tony Khan’s reply says anything, it’s that he’s still swinging. He’s not backing down—and he’s more than happy to troll doubters who think WWE’s pressure will fold AEW.

Tony Khan’s clapback shows he’s standing firm in the AEW trenches. Whether AEW continues to thrive or struggles under the heat WWE’s throwing their way, one thing’s for sure—Khan’s not entertaining the idea of closing shop.
